EUNUTNET (European Network for Public Health Nutrition: Networking, Monitoring, Intervention and Training) is a European Commission funded project (SPC 2003320) co-ordinated by Agneta Yngve, Unit for Preventive Nutrition, Department of Biosciences, Karolinska Institute. The project brought together European scientists and public health experts in order to, inter alia, ensure the development and implementation of sustainable evidence-based coherent training and promotion strategies on nutrition and physical activity. Within EUNUTNET, a task force coordinated by Adriano Cattaneo, Unit for Health Services Research and International Health, Institute for Child Health IRCCS Burlo Garofolo, has drawn up, after extensive review of the search evidence and much consultation, these standard recommendations on infant and young child feeding to complement the Blueprint for Action for the Protection, Promotion and Support of Breastfeeding in Europe (European Commission funded project SPC 2002359). These recommendations, once published and launched, will be offered to relevant national associations, organizations and government bodies as a guide to professional practice in Europe.
